Skip to content

Commit cea75c0

Browse files
committed
Fix broken monkey patch. :/
1 parent 052d07d commit cea75c0

File tree

1 file changed

+1
-0
lines changed

1 file changed

+1
-0
lines changed

lib/postgres_ext/active_record/relation/predicate_builder.rb

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-29,6 +29,7 @@ def self.build_from_hash(engine, attributes, default_table, allow_table_name = t
2929
value = value.select(value.klass.arel_table[value.klass.primary_key]) if value.select_values.empty?
3030
attribute.in(value.arel.ast)
3131
when Array, ActiveRecord::Associations::CollectionProxy
32+
table = table.left if table.is_a?(Arel::Nodes::TableAlias)
3233
column_definition = engine.connection.columns(table.name).find { |col| col.name == column }
3334

3435
if column_definition.respond_to?(:array) && column_definition.array

0 commit comments

Comments
 (0)